September can be a stressful month. It feels like so much has been changing, not just the seasons, but levels of happiness and stress. No matter what stress that comes unexpectedly through work and life, we can always prepare remedies to help calm our outbreaks.

September Stresses are a real thing. Life and work can weigh in as much as we can find ways out.

Managing stress in healthy ways may help reduce how often you have a genital herpes outbreak. Ongoing stress -- that lasting more than a week -- seems to trigger outbreaks more than any other lifestyle factor.

  1. Get some sleep
  2. Balance your diet and exercise
  3. Reach out and talk about it
  4. Relax and take care of you
